Which Blade Types Are Most Effective for Budget Hair Clippers?

The most effective blade types for budget hair clippers are stainless steel and ceramic blades.

  1. Stainless Steel Blades
  2. Ceramic Blades

Stainless Steel Blades:
Stainless steel blades are popular in budget hair clippers for their durability and cost-effectiveness. They resist corrosion and maintain sharpness well. According to a study by Grooming Expert (2021), stainless steel blades can last longer than other materials when properly maintained. These blades are suitable for various hair types and can provide a clean cut. Their affordability makes them accessible in many budget-friendly clipper models.

Ceramic Blades:
Ceramic blades are known for their sharpness and smooth cutting action. They generate less heat, reducing the risk of skin irritation during use. Research from the Hair Care Journal (2022) highlights that ceramic blades tend to stay sharp longer than stainless steel. However, they are also more fragile and can chip if dropped. Despite this, their performance makes them a sought-after option in some budget clippers.

Both blade types offer unique advantages, catering to different user preferences and hair types. Selecting the right type hinges on the desired quality and care level of the clipper.

How Can You Maintain Low Cost Hair Clippers to Ensure Longevity?

You can maintain low-cost hair clippers by regularly cleaning them, properly lubricating the blades, storing them correctly, and avoiding excessive use.

Regular cleaning is essential. Hair clippers accumulate hair, dust, and oils that can hinder performance. Use a small brush to remove hair from the blades. You can also use a mild disinfectant solution to wipe down the outer surfaces. This practice can improve hygiene and ensure the clippers operate efficiently. A study by Miller (2020) suggested that regular maintenance could enhance the lifespan of grooming tools.

Proper lubrication is critical for blade performance. Blades require lubrication to prevent friction and overheating. Use clipper oil specifically designed for this purpose. Apply a few drops on the blades before and after each use. This action can help prevent dullness and extend the operational life of the clippers.

Correct storage prevents damage. Store the clippers in a dry, cool place, away from moisture and heat. Consider using a protective case or pouch to avoid accidental drops or exposure to dust. Proper storage helps maintain the clippers’ condition over time.

Avoiding excessive use is important for longevity. Limit continuous usage to prevent overheating and excessive wear on the motor. Follow the manufacturer’s recommendations for usage time. This guideline helps prevent burn-out and maintains the clipper’s functionality.

By implementing these maintenance strategies, you can enhance the performance and longevity of low-cost hair clippers effectively.
